Hi I’m Ahmad, an Iraqi-Australian storyteller. My fascination with photography began at a very young age experimenting with disposable cameras. Photography to me is a mode of expression, a portal in time and a way to convey my stories visually. My work aims to showcase surreal natural landscapes, unique destinations and cinematic scenery from a bygone era. A good photograph will speak to you, alter your consciousness and leave you in a state of contemplation.
Here are a few fleeting moments, captured on 35mm film.
